Replace printf("Enter the string: "); This website uses cookies. WebR - df []R - In a character string, find a word given in first column of df and replace it by its corresponding word in second column This programto replace last character occurrenceis the same as above. How to replace line breaks in a string in C#? Try this, it worked for me: #include Add String into existing String whenever specific characters found, String replace with dictionary exception handling, Replace multiple `Match`es without `MatchEvaluator`'s restrictions. What function is to replace a substring from a string in C? A value of string::npos indicates all characters until the end of the string. Replace All Rights Reserved. That doesn't do every instance, thoughand this is really fragile since you are using a static buffer. A-143, 9th Floor, Sovereign Corporate Tower, We use cookies to ensure you have the best browsing experience on our website. For Loop First Iteration: for(i = 0; i <= strlen(str); i++)The condition is True because i <= 5.if(typeof ez_ad_units!='undefined'){ez_ad_units.push([[300,250],'tutorialgateway_org-box-4','ezslot_4',181,'0','0'])};__ez_fad_position('div-gpt-ad-tutorialgateway_org-box-4-0'); Within the While Loop, we usedIf statementto check whether the str[0] is equal to a user-specified character or not. document.getElementById( "ak_js_1" ).setAttribute( "value", ( new Date() ).getTime() ); , [Kotlin]MutableList(), Map()(Key), shuffled()MutableLlist, (array)MutableList(), removeAll()(mutableList)(), minOf()(List). There are various string operations, such as string searching, substring generation, getchar (); // which letter to replace the existing one printf ("enter The nature of simulating nature: A Q&A with IBM Quantum researcher Dr. Jamie We've added a "Necessary cookies only" option to the cookie consent popup. static char buffer[4096]; Read our. It is necessary to declare a second char array. WebThere are two parameters in the replace method: the first parameter is the character to replace & the second one is the character to be replaced with. Check out the links below to understand how strings can A Computer Science portal for geeks. How to replace one char by another using std::string in replace I have created following extension methods to perform this operation: public static string Replace(this string str, Dictionary dict) { StringBuilder sb = new StringBuilder(str); return You get an integer ? not a character ? If it is a character, then you should use %c instead of %d If you would like to change your settings or withdraw consent at any time, the link to do so is in our privacy policy accessible from our home page.. It is more efficient as it uses only extra space for the new characters to be inserted. WebThis is C Program that asks user to replace the character from the existing one.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ions. a character dropLast()(string), dropLast()(string)+, +dropLast(), +(string), . Can I tell police to wait and call a lawyer when served with a search warrant? Is it possible to create a concave light? #i and output. Replace a Character How can I explain to my manager that a project he wishes to undertake cannot be performed by the team? Replace function Method 2: This method involves inplace update of string. Why is there a voltage on my HDMI and coaxial cables? The output of this program shown below. Use replace function to replace space with 'ch' character. Basic C programming, Loop, String, Function. Syntax. Can archive.org's Wayback Machine ignore some query terms? It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ions. Doubling the cube, field extensions and minimal polynoms. The nature of simulating nature: A Q&A with IBM Quantum researcher Dr. Jamie We've added a "Necessary cookies only" option to the cookie consent popup. Do NOT follow this link or you will be banned from the site. C Program to Replace Last Occurrence of a Character in a String, C Program to Remove First Occurrence of a Character in a String. It's not a copy of the original string from start to finish. Acidity of alcohols and basicity of amines. #include Here is C source code for replacing the character from string. will be "brock". String To solve this problem, we need to manipulate strings. fgets(str,sizeof(st Here are examples of both approaches: Using I am trying to replace a certain character in my string with multiple characters. So if I have a big dictionary and small number of tokens in the input string that actually can give my app a boost. often are the preferred data type in various applications and are used as the datatype for input Not the answer you're looking for? Using [] operator Unlike Java, strings in C++ are mutable. Find centralized, trusted content and collaborate around the technologies you use most. How to replace table names with object types in a string? Fourth Iteration: for(i = 3; 3 < 5; 3++)if(str[i] == ch) =>if(l == l) condition is Truestr[i] = Newchstr[3] = @if(typeof ez_ad_units!='undefined'){ez_ad_units.push([[250,250],'tutorialgateway_org-large-leaderboard-2','ezslot_6',183,'0','0'])};__ez_fad_position('div-gpt-ad-tutorialgateway_org-large-leaderboard-2-0'); Fifth Iteration: for(i = 4; 4 < 5; 4++)if(str[i] == ch) =>if(0 == l) condition is False.str[i] = Newchstr[3] = @The above condition is false. Continue with Recommended Cookies. By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. WebThis post will discuss how to replace a character at a particular index in a string in C++.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ions. Steps to remove special characters from String PythonTake input from the user or define the string from which you want to remove the special characters.Define a new empty string named final_string to store the alphanumeric characters.Apply for loop to access each character in the string and check the character is alphanumeric by using the isalnum () method.More items To replace specific character with another character in a string in C++, we can use std::string::replace() method of the algorithm library. To view the purposes they believe they have legitimate interest for, or to object to this data processing use the vendor list link below. scanf("%d",&a); How Intuit democratizes AI development across teams through reusability. On the other hand, no explanation is present, so I may be wrong. To use the replace() method, we shall include algorithm header/library in our program. Using String.Remove () method. C++ A Computer Science portal for geeks. Dynamic Memory Allocation in C using malloc(), calloc(), free() and realloc(). Identify those arcade games from a 1983 Brazilian music video, Can Martian Regolith be Easily Melted with Microwaves. in a Binary String to make the count of 0s and 1s same as that of another string, Replace even-indexed characters of minimum number of substrings to convert a string to another, C++ Program To Find Longest Common Prefix Using Word By Word Matching, Python Program To Find Longest Common Prefix Using Word By Word Matching, Javascript Program To Find Longest Common Prefix Using Word By Word Matching, Java Program To Find Longest Common Prefix Using Word By Word Matching. If you would like to change your settings or withdraw consent at any time, the link to do so is in our privacy policy accessible from our home page.. String_variable [ ] = . What is the correct way to screw wall and ceiling drywalls? WebDownload Run Code. string input = "This is a string with multiple characters to replace"; string output = input.Replace('i', '1').Replace('s', '2').Replace('t', '3'); It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ions. WebAsyncCallback Attribute AttributeTargets AttributeUsageAttribute BadImageFormatException Base64FormattingOptions BitConverter Boolean Buffer Byte rev2023.3.3.43278. How to find and replace string in MySQL database for a particular string only? char temp[20]=""; int main(void) 2) Overwrite it with the first of the three characters you want to put in. C - Delete spaces around specific char in string. WebThis method performs a search to find oldValue using the provided culture and ignoreCase case sensitivity.. Because this method returns the modified string, you can chain together successive calls to the Replace method to perform multiple replacements on the original string. This programto replace all character occurrences is the same as above. Here, the condition is True so,str[index] =Newchstr[3] = @, At last, we used the printf statement to print the final string. You could control the ordering using a List> instead. Display the result on screen. Signup to jumpstart your coding career - Studytonight Declaring the variable. { Whenever we encounter the character stored in variable f within the given range, we replace it with the character stored in r. We find out the string after this replacement operation.